dedication

Intermediate (B1)

IPA: /ˌdɛdɪˈkeɪʃən/

KK: /ˌdɛdɪˈkeɪʃən/

noun
Definition

The act of committing oneself to a task or purpose, often showing strong loyalty and effort.


Example

Her dedication to her studies helped her achieve excellent grades.

Root Explanation

Dedication is formed from "dedicare" (meaning to consecrate or devote) and the suffix "-tion" (indicating the action or process of). The word refers to the act of devoting oneself to a particular purpose or task.
